- 1、本文档共36页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第8章 计算机网络接口 西安交通大学计算机系 桂小林 * 目录 8.1 以太网络接口的基本概念 8.2 RTL8019AS以太网接口控制器 8.3 DM9000A以太网接口控制器 ================== 9.1 PS/2键盘接口 9.2 显示器接口 概述 计算机网络接口已经成为计算机系统的常用接口之一。互联网络是广泛使用的计算机网络,其核心是以太网。 本章首先介绍以太网接口的基本概念,包括帧结构、RJ45连接器及其接线方法; 然后介绍微型计算机中使用最多的以太网接口控制芯片RTL8019的原理与编程结构; 最后介绍一种嵌入式系统使用广泛的以太网接口控制芯片DM9000A的原理、结构及其应用编程。 8.1 以太网络接口的基本概念 以太网(Ethernet)具有共享介质特征,信息采用明文的形式在网络上传输,当网络适配器设置为监听模式时,由于采用以太网广播信道争用的方式,使得监听系统与正常通信的网络能够并联连接,并可以捕获任何一个在同一冲突域上传输的数据包。 IEEE802.3标准的以太网采用的是持续CSMA的工作方式。 8.1.1以太网MAC层物理传输帧 PR:用于同步位,是收发双方的时钟同步,也指明了传输的速率(10M和100M的时钟频率不一样,所以100M网卡可以兼容10M网卡),是56位的二进制1010.....,共7个字节的AAH SD:分隔位,表示下面跟着的是真正的数据,为8位跟同步位不同的是最后2位是11而不是10. DA:目的地址,以太网的地址为48位(6个字节)二进制地址,表明该帧传输给哪个网卡. SA:源地址,48位,表明该帧的数据是哪个网卡发的,即发送端的网卡地址,同样是6个字节. TYPE:类型字段,表明该帧的数据是什么类型的数据,不同的协议的类型字段不同。如:0800H 表示数据为IP包,0806H 表示数据为ARP包,814CH是SNMP包,8137H为IPX/SPX包,(小于0600H的值是用于IEEE802的,表示数据包的长度。) DATA:数据段 ,该段数据不能超过1500字节。因为以太网规定整个传输包的最大长度不能超过1514字节。(14字节为DA,SA,TYPE) PAD:填充位。由于以太网帧传输的数据包最小不能小于60字节, 除去(DA,SA,TYPE 14字节),还必须传输46字节的数据,当数据段的数据不足46字节时,后面补000000.....(当然也可以补其它值) FCS:32位数据校验位.为32位的CRC校验,该校验由网卡自动计算,自动生成,自动校验,自动在数据段后面填入.对于数据的校验算法,我们无需了解. 事实上PR、SD、PAD、FCS这几个数据段是由网卡自动产生的;只需要理解DA、SA、TYPE、DATA四个段的内容。 所有数据位的传输由低位开始(传输的位流使用曼彻斯特编码) ,以太网的冲突退避算法是由硬件自动执行的。 DA+SA+TYPE+DATA+PAD最小为60字节,最大为1514字节。 以太网卡可以接收三种地址的数据,一个是广播地位,一个是多播地址,一个是它自已的地址。 从硬件的角度看,以太网接口电路主要由MAC控制器和物理层接口(Physical Layer,PHY)两大部分构成。 目前常见的以太网接口芯片,如RTL8019、RTL8029、RTL8139、CS8900、DM9000A、DM9008等,其内部结构也主要包含这两部分。 在嵌入式系统中,与常规的PC计算机网卡设计思路不同。因为嵌入时系统中通常不考虑ISA、PCI总线接口,因此,嵌入式系统的以太网络接口是一个精简接口。 图8-1给出了嵌入式系统中以太网接口电路的一般框图。其中包括嵌入式微处理器、以太网络芯片、隔离变压器和RJ45插座四部分。 8.1.2以太网RJ45引脚定义及接线方法 10/100Base-T以太网采用RJ45连接器。RJ45接口通常用于数据传输,共有八芯做成 RJ45连接器根据线的排序不同分为两种方法, 一种是T568A标准,线的顺序是橙白、橙、绿白、蓝、蓝白、绿、棕白、棕; 另一种是T568B标准,线的顺序是绿白、绿、橙白、蓝、蓝白、橙、棕白、棕。 根据上述两种标准,RJ45连接器的连接方法也有两种: 直通线(两端使用同一种标准)、 交叉线(两端使用不同标准,即线1与线3交换,线2与线6交换)。 当PC计算机与PC计算机间实现网络互联时,采用交叉线模式,即一端采用T568A标准,另一端采用T568B标准。 表8-3给出了PC与PC间的RJ45连接方法。 表8-3给出了RJ45连接器各引脚的信号定义。 8.2 RTL8019AS以太网接口控制器 以太网接口控制器RTL8019AS是台湾REALTEK公司设计开发的一种高
您可能关注的文档
最近下载
- 临床路径培训(共29张课件).pptx VIP
- 2024年《全国教育大会》专题PPT课件.ppt
- 介入应急预案演练(坠床).docx
- JTG B05-2015《公路项目安全性评价规范》释义手册_(高清版).pdf
- 第四单元 三国两晋南北朝时期:孕育统一和民族交融单元质检卷(B卷)--2024-2025学年统编版七年级历史上册.docx VIP
- 二类医疗器械管理培训试题.pdf
- 乡镇建房地基购买合同5篇.docx
- 职业生涯报告(通用8篇).pdf VIP
- QGDW 10278-2021 变电站接地网技术规范.docx
- 第四单元 三国两晋南北朝时期:孕育统一和民族交融单元质检卷(A卷)--2024-2025学年统编版七年级历史上册.docx VIP
文档评论(0)